The Ultimate Guide to Mastering Piano Tiles: Strategies, Evolution, and Gameplay Mechanics

Piano Tiles, often known as Don’t Tap the White Tile, revolutionized the casual mobile gaming landscape upon its release in 2014. Developed by Cheetah Mobile, the game’s core premise is deceivingly simple: tap the black tiles as they scroll down the screen while avoiding the white ones. As the rhythm accelerates, the game transforms from a relaxing musical exercise into a high-octane test of reflexes, pattern recognition, and finger dexterity. To excel at Piano Tiles, players must move beyond basic reaction speeds and adopt advanced techniques such as multi-finger mapping, rhythmic synchronization, and psychological focus.

The Mechanics of Mastery: From Novice to Virtuoso

The fundamental mechanics of Piano Tiles rely on the synchronization between visual input and motor output. Unlike traditional rhythm games that follow a fixed beat, Piano Tiles is reactive; the speed of the tiles is dictated by the player’s tapping frequency. In the initial stages, players often rely on a single-finger approach, tapping centrally as tiles descend. While this works for slow-tempo tracks, it is insufficient for "Arcade" or "Speed" modes where tiles appear in dense clusters.

Mastery begins with "Multi-Finger Allocation." Professional players typically utilize at least two fingers—often the index and middle fingers of the dominant hand, or a combination of both hands. By splitting the screen into vertical zones, the player reduces the distance their fingers need to travel. This zoning technique allows for a more fluid motion, transforming the gameplay from frantic tapping into a rhythmic flow. Furthermore, maintaining a "soft touch" is critical; excessive pressure on the glass screen increases friction, slowing down the transition between taps and fatiguing the hand muscles prematurely.

Advanced Strategies for High Scores

To achieve top-tier scores, players must treat the game as a pattern recognition task rather than a reactive one. The human eye has a limited reaction time, typically around 200–250 milliseconds. At the game’s peak speeds, relying solely on immediate visual input results in "misses" because the brain cannot process the data fast enough. Instead, advanced players utilize "Look-Ahead Scanning."

Look-Ahead Scanning involves focusing your gaze on the middle of the screen rather than the bottom. By tracking the incoming patterns (the "chords") before they reach the tap zone, you allow your brain to pre-calculate the required finger movements. This predictive processing is the hallmark of elite players. Additionally, players should minimize their "dead zone" movement. Keep your fingers as close to the screen as possible at all times; lifting fingers high into the air introduces a significant time penalty for every tap. Efficiency is the bridge between a good score and a world-record-breaking performance.

The Psychological Aspect: Focus and Flow

Piano Tiles is as much a psychological challenge as it is a physical one. The phenomenon known as "Flow State" is essential for sustaining high-speed performance. Flow is achieved when the challenge of the game perfectly matches the player’s skill level, resulting in deep immersion where the player feels like they are playing on autopilot.

To maintain this state, players must manage "performance anxiety," which often spikes during the mid-game when speeds begin to fluctuate rapidly. If your heart rate increases and your focus drifts to your score rather than the tiles, you will inevitably experience a lapse in concentration. Implementing controlled breathing techniques between sets or during slightly slower sections of the music can help reset your focus. Consistency, rather than intensity, is what leads to long-term improvement in rhythm gaming.

Evolution of the Genre: Piano Tiles 2 and Beyond

The original Piano Tiles title paved the way for successors like Piano Tiles 2, which shifted the focus from endless, abstract tapping to organized, song-based progression. This shift added a layer of musicality to the experience; players were no longer just tapping squares—they were "playing" classics by composers like Chopin, Beethoven, and Mozart.

The integration of music transformed the game from a stress-test into a cognitive reward system. When the taps correspond to the melody, the brain processes the patterns more efficiently through auditory cues. If a player is intimately familiar with the melody of the song they are playing, they can often predict the next cluster of tiles based on the rhythm, even if they have never played that specific level before. This is why players are encouraged to wear headphones; the tactile feedback of the taps synchronized with the auditory feedback of the music creates a powerful sensory loop that improves performance accuracy.

Optimizing Your Hardware for Performance

Hardware constraints can significantly impact your performance in Piano Tiles. Lag, whether it is visual or input-based, is the silent killer of high scores.

  1. Refresh Rate: Higher refresh rate screens (90Hz or 120Hz) provide more visual information per second, making fast-moving tiles appear smoother and easier to track.
  2. Touch Sampling Rate: This is the frequency at which the touchscreen registers your input. A higher sampling rate reduces the latency between your tap and the software registration, ensuring that every touch is recorded precisely when intended.
  3. Screen Cleanliness: Oil buildup on the screen increases drag and can cause "ghost touches" or failure to register light taps. Using a micro-fiber cloth to clean the screen before a serious session is a non-negotiable ritual for competitive players.
  4. Device Orientation: Playing on a tablet or a larger smartphone screen can be advantageous if you are using a multi-finger claw grip, but it requires more travel distance for your hands. Find the balance that suits your hand size.

Common Pitfalls and How to Avoid Them

Even experienced players fall into common traps that lead to plateaus. One of the most frequent errors is "Pattern Overthinking." When players anticipate a difficult sequence, they often tense up, causing their fingers to move rigidly. Rigidity destroys timing.

Another pitfall is the "Endless Mode Trap." Players often grind the hardest levels for hours without break. However, muscle memory is solidified during rest, not during the grind. If you find yourself consistently failing at the same point in a song, take a ten-minute break. This allows your central nervous system to stabilize and reset, preventing "tilt"—the state of frustration that leads to increasingly sloppy play.

The Science of Rhythmic Gaming

Piano Tiles sits at the intersection of neuroscience and entertainment. Research into rhythm-based games suggests they improve neuroplasticity—the brain’s ability to reorganize itself by forming new neural connections. By forcing the brain to synchronize vision, sound, and fine motor movement at increasing speeds, players are effectively training their brains to process information more quickly.

The game acts as a form of high-speed cognitive training. The "Don’t Tap the White Tile" rule is a perfect example of "inhibition training," where the brain must suppress the urge to tap specific areas while focusing on others. This cognitive control is a transferable skill that benefits executive functions such as impulse control and sustained attention.

Building a Training Routine

To reach the upper echelons of the Piano Tiles community, you need a structured training regimen.

  • Warm-up: Spend five minutes on a slow-tempo song to calibrate your touch and focus on perfect accuracy.
  • Drill Phase: Spend 15 minutes focusing on your weakest pattern (e.g., rapid triplets or alternating side-to-side clusters). Slow down the speed if possible and focus on the mechanics of the movement until it feels effortless.
  • Performance Phase: Spend your peak energy on high-difficulty tracks. Attempt to set a new personal record while recording your screen.
  • Review: Watch your recordings in slow motion. Identify where your eyes were looking versus where your fingers were moving. Most players discover that they are looking too far down at the bottom of the screen, which limits their reaction time.
